Paroles

At Shakespeare’s happy birth,
With fire etherial, Jove his soul endow’d;
Then bade him spurn the narrow bounds of earth,
And sordid wishes of the grov’ling crowd
That chain the free-born mind. ‘And take’, he said,
‘This sacred charge, O Fancy. To his sight glancing,
In all their colours be display’d
The airy forms which sport
In thy pure fields of light.
For his vast mind, with innate wisdom fraught,
Beyond what taught the bards of yore,
Thy trackless regions boldly shall explore,
I guiding. Thus, O goddess, have I sworn.’
Written by: French Lawrence, Thomas Linley, Jr.
